Meghan Markle set to avoid UK return again as Prince Harry determined to heal royal rift

Meghan Markle is reportedly not set to join Prince Harry in the UK later this month when the Duke will head to London for the WellChild awards.

Meghan Markle is set for a double snub of the UK as Prince Harry prepares to make a solo trip later this month.

The former actress is not set to join Harry in the UK nor attend the 2024 WellChild awards in London on September 30.

The Duke of Sussex’s attendance at the annual awards ceremony was confirmed last week, with the royal – who has been patron of the charity for 16 years – having been associated with the event for over a decade.

Speaking about Harry’s solo visit last year, GB News’s royal editor Svar Nanan-Sen told royal correspondent Cameron Walker that this year’s visit could be the same – with Meghan having not joined him for the 2023 awards.

Mr Nanan-Sen said: “It’s interesting, last year he [Harry] came back here for the WellChild awards and on September 7 [and] spent just a night in the UK and then immediately flew to Germany for the Invictus Games.

“Meghan Markle chose not to accompany Harry to the UK but then made the flight across to Europe anyway, and flew to the Invictus Games [in Germany] two days later and it was seen, at the time, as a snub.

“Meghan is not expected to join him on his trip to the UK this year for the WellChild awards but we may see Harry stick around for more than just a couple of days.”

Mr Nanan-Sen also added that, in extension to the awards ceremony – Harry could visit King Charles. They last met back in February when Harry flew to the UK after news of the King’s cancer diagnosis was made public.

WellChild appeared delighted to confirm Harry’s attendance, taking to X to share the news. They wrote: “We are delighted to announce that WellChild Patron Prince Harry, The Duke of Sussex, will attend the 2024 WellChild Awards, in association with @GSK, on 30th Sept. The Duke will meet our inspirational winners at a pre-ceremony reception before joining them in the main event.”

During this year’s appearance, the Duke of Sussex will present one of the inspirational winners with their awards and also deliver a speech.

He said: “I am once again honoured to attend this year’s WellChild Awards celebrating the remarkable courage and achievements of children living with complex medical needs.”

Meghan has not visited the UK since September 2022. Harry and Meghan were due to attend the WellChild awards on September 8, 2022, but – following the death of the late Queen Elizabeth II earlier that day – the couple did not attend.
